标题:ClickHouse 的应用场景及其成功案例分析
随着大数据时代的到来,数据处理和分析工具的重要性日益凸显。ClickHouse 作为一种列式数据库管理系统,因其高效的数据压缩和查询速度而广受赞誉。它适用于需要快速处理大量数据分析的场景,特别是在实时分析、日志分析、时序数据分析等领域有着出色的表现。
首先,让我们来了解一下 ClickHouse 最适合哪些应用场景:
-
实时数据分析
在电子商务、社交媒体、在线游戏等互联网行业中,企业需要对用户行为进行实时分析以做出快速反应。ClickHouse 提供了高效的查询性能,可以支持每秒数百万行数据的插入,并且能够在几秒钟内完成复杂查询,这使得它非常适合用于构建实时数据分析系统。
-
日志分析
对于拥有海量日志文件的企业来说,传统的日志分析方法往往效率低下。ClickHouse 的架构设计特别适合于处理大规模的日志数据。它能够迅速解析并汇总来自不同来源的日志信息,帮助企业监控系统健康状态、排查问题根源以及优化业务流程。
-
时序数据分析
物联网(IoT)、智能电网等行业产生的时序数据具有高度的连续性和规律性。ClickHouse 支持时间序列数据的高效存储与检索,允许用户轻松执行趋势预测、异常检测等任务,为决策提供有力支持。
接下来,我们将通过三个具体案例来展示 ClickHouse 在实际应用中的优势:
案例一:某大型电商平台采用了 ClickHouse 来提升其营销活动效果评估的速度。以往使用 MySQL 进行同类查询可能需要几分钟甚至更长时间,而改用 ClickHouse 后,同样的查询仅需几秒钟即可完成,大大提高了运营团队的工作效率。
案例二:一家国际知名的社交网络平台利用 ClickHouse 构建了一套全面的日志分析系统。该系统每天处理超过 PB 级别的日志数据,不仅实现了对服务器性能的实时监控,还帮助开发人员及时发现并解决了多个潜在的安全隐患。
案例三:一个专注于智慧城市的科技公司选择 ClickHouse 来管理城市交通流量监测设备所产生的时序数据。借助 ClickHouse 强大的查询能力和高并发处理特性,该公司成功地为城市规划者提供了准确可靠的交通流量预测服务,有效缓解了高峰时段的道路拥堵情况。
综上所述,ClickHouse 凭借其卓越的技术特点,在多种数据分析场景中展现出了无可比拟的优势。无论是初创企业还是大型跨国公司,都可以考虑将其作为首选的数据处理解决方案之一。希望这篇介绍能让您对 ClickHouse 有一个更加清晰的认识。